How many business days after the employee pay date do I have to originate the ACH Credit transfer?

0

If the employee works in Oregon, the withholding must be submitted within seven business days. If you are an out-of-state employer, you must follow the laws of the state where the employee is principally employed. The Office of Child Support Enforcement provides state-by-state income withholding information.
